LaunchTrends®: New Products in Multiple Sclerosis
A series of reports tracking the response to and uptake of Acorda’s AMPYRA (dalfampridine) and Novartis’ EXTAVIA (interferon β-1b) and their impact on the Multiple Sclerosis market.
Study Overview:
LaunchTrends® are syndicated reports that track the trial, adoption and usage of new products. These report series provide information on how new products fit into the treatment algorithm, impact current therapies and change market dynamics. They also provide information on awareness, familiarity, perceived clinical advantages and disadvantages of new products, and the promotional messages and activities of all market players.
Methodology:
A total of four waves of research will occur. A baseline wave was published in January 2010 on the initial response to EXTAVIA. In the remaining waves, neurologists will complete a self-administered online survey, providing information about their perceptions, attitudes and usage of AMPYRA and EXTAVIA. Following the survey, a subset of respondents will participate in qualitative phone interviews to probe into reasons for anticipated action or inaction as well as details surrounding the promotion of AMPYRA and EXTAVIA.
Sample Frame:
In each of the four waves, a random sample of 75 neurologists will participate in the online quantitative survey. A subset of the survey respondents (n=20) will participate in each wave of the qualitative phone interviews. Each wave will consist of unique respondents.
Timing:
The Baseline report following the EXTAVIA launch was published on January 13, 2010. Wave 1 was fielded one month (April 2010) post launch of AMPYRA and published on May 28, 2010. The remaining two waves will be fielded at four (July 2010) and seven (October 2010) months post launch of AMPYRA.
